MADISON - Attorney General Van Hollen will attend the kick-off ceremonies for Torch Run events in Madison on Wednesday, June 9, and Thursday, June 10 as an Honorary Chair. Van Hollen will give brief statements at both events.
Wednesday, June 9, 2010
Law Enforcement Torch Run Final Leg Kickoff Ceremony
Noon 1:00p.m.
NE Corner of State Capitol
Corner of N. Pinckney St. & E. Mifflin St.
&
Thursday, June 10, 2010
Law Enforcement Torch Run Madison to Portage Final Leg
6:00 a.m. registration, 7:00 a.m. departure
Begins at E Side of State Capitol
The Law Enforcement Torch Run will take the Flame of Hope from Madison to the Opening Ceremonies of the State Summer Games in Stevens Point. The event is organized by Special Olympics Wisconsin.
